Business Administration & Management graduates with a bachelor’s degree from Brooklyn report a median salary of $54,693 a year. This is below $59,504, the median for all majors at Brooklyn.
To complete a bachelor’s at Brooklyn, business administration & management graduates take on a median debt of $11,000 in student loans. This is below $13,303, the typical median for all majors at Brooklyn.
